The Compute project has many new features added along with the addition of proprietary drivers by third party vendors.
Priority of a blueprint is decided by the developers who are committed to that particular project.
Glance has few blueprints implemented. One reason: the project is relatively mature.
Storage policy seems to be one common feature added to most of these projects.
The OpenStack dashboard has a relative larger number of features added. That is in part due to the integration of the Sahara project, which aims to bring data intensive application cluster on top of OpenStack.

OpenStack Neutron blueprint has considerable activity. One of the main reason: networking vendors are adding their driver to the Neutron Core. Neutron brings network as a service to OpenStack. Project details can be found at https://wiki.openstack.org/wiki/Neutron.
